Transaction 77ac621bfb81651b5c11b5b4d0e8fe689f2df6010d804bafe142322712526536
1 Input
1 Output
-
77ac621bfb81651b5c11b5b4d0e8fe689f2df6010d804bafe142322712526536:0
- value
- 49990933
- script pubkey
- OP_0 OP_PUSHBYTES_20 63751a7e7699eb34d6b022ade08873e0470a5a07
- address
- bc1qvd635lnkn84nf44sy2k7pzrnuprs5ks87pd4tv